The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io. The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ted book value per share of a company over the past 10 years.

Hingham Institution forvings's adjusted book value per share data for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was €190.380. Add all the adjusted book value per share for the past 10 years together and divide the count will get our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share, which is €139.17 for the trailing ten years ended in Mar. 2026.

Hingham Institution forvings  (FRA:HS3)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PB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of book value during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io should give similar results to regular PB Ratio.

Hingham Institution forvings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io takes the Book Value per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/B cal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PB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io.

Hingham Institution forvings's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share
=244.00/139.17
=1.75

Hingham Institution forvings Business Description

Other Exchanges HIFS:USA
Address 55 Main Street, Hingham, MA, USA, 02043
Hingham Institution for Savings is a Massachusetts-chartered savings bank headquartered in Hingham, Massachusetts. The bank is principally engaged in the business of commercial and residential real estate mortgage lending, funded by a mix of retail and commercial deposits, wholesale deposits and borrowings. Its primary deposit products are savings, checking, and term certificate accounts, and its primary lending products are residential and commercial mortgage loans secured by properties in eastern Massachusetts. The bank also lends to commercial and residential real estate borrowers and services deposits for customers in the greater Washington, D.C. metropolitan area (WMA) and in the San Francisco Bay Area.
